Recently, it was revealed Scarlett Johnasson is suing Disney over a breach of contract regarding the hybrid release of her superhero film, “Black Widow.” Reports claim the actress is expected to lose upwards of $50 million after “Black Widow” was released simultaneously in theaters and on Disney+ Premier Access.
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son will not be taking the Scarlett Johansson route following the Video On Demand release of his new film, it has been claimed.Like Johansson’s Marvel entry Black Widow, Johnson’s new film Jungle Cruise was released simultaneously in cinemas and Disney+ Premier for $29.99 last Friday (July 30).

Scarlett Johansson found her pandemic wedding to Saturday Night Live star Colin Jost "a little stressful". The October 2020 wedding was organised to comply with strict Covid-19 safeguards, and the Black Widow actress has revealed just how much they had to do to keep Jost's elderly family members safe.
